The Department

The Office of the General Counsel (OGC) manages complex legal and risk issues for the firm, our board, partners and executive management. We focus on all elements of professional practice risk, including claims, complaints, core regulatory compliance, enterprise risk management, legal advisory and governance.

The team is spread across our region, including London, Glasgow, Milton Keynes, and Dubai, with the team working in a hybrid model, and is made up of qualified lawyers and other qualified specialists. This allows us to offer a distinct viewpoint and create innovative solutions for the risk challenges that emerge throughout the Firm.

The Role

We are seeking an experienced and highly skilled Senior Employment/Partnership Counsel to join our Office of General Counsel. This position is well-suited for someone with experience as a Partner in a law firm or at an equivalent level.

The ideal candidate will have a deep understanding of employment law in the UK and will be responsible for providing strategic guidance on legal matters to the firm’s partnership and partners. The role will be pivotal in ensuring that Dentons navigates complex employment law matters with precision and foresight, safeguarding the firm’s interests.

This work will include:

  • Deliver high-level legal advice on intricate employment / partnership law issues, specifically tailored to the needs of the firm’s partnership, partners, executive management and board, including but not limited to discrimination, unfair dismissal, employee relations, performance management, internal investigations, employment rights and termination issues.
  • Work closely with Employee Relations Manager, HR Team and Head of Risk to manage risks associated with partners, board and executive leadership.
  • Oversee the development and implementation of employment strategies and partner policies that align with the firm’s strategic objectives, maintaining compliance with ethical, legal and SRA standards.
  • Draft, review, and negotiate sophisticated legal documents, including partnership agreements, severance packages, and non-compete clauses, ensuring they reflect best practices and legal requirements.
  • Oversee the firm’s compliance with employment laws, providing proactive risk management solutions and ensuring adherence to legal and SRA standards.
  • Represent the firm and its partners in high-stakes legal proceedings, including arbitration, mediations and court cases, demonstrating exceptional advocacy skills.
  • Stay at the forefront of legal developments in employment / partnership law, advising the partnership on emerging risks.
  • Cultivate and manage key relationships with board members, partners, executive management, Employee Relations Manager, Head of Risk and external legal advisors, acting as a trusted counsel and strategic partner.
  • Provide guidance and oversight on partner matters related to ethics, risk management and professional responsibility.
